Multisensori is capable of displaying effectively one colour at any time as it sends relative RGB values to the LEDs.
It is a totally digital system though, so the lightbrightness and flash control should not vary from unit to unit ( ie more fool-proof ) whereas Audiostrobe can be effected by audio signal noise and input volume level.
